Curling or Fastening Roofing Shingles
Occasionally, you may observe curling or twisting roof shingles on your roof covering, which's a clear indicator something's incorrect. This issue commonly shows that your tiles are aging or have actually been endangered. When roof shingles crinkle, they shed their performance, permitting water to permeate under them, potentially leading to leakages and more damages.
You should take note of whether the curling is occurring at the edges or in the middle of the tiles. Edges crinkling upwards recommend that your shingles are drying out, while those crinkling downwards may suggest wetness issues below the surface area.
Bending roof shingles, on the other hand, can signal that your roof covering's underlayment isn't supplying correct assistance, which can cause architectural problems over time.
Neglecting these signs can escalate concerns, causing pricey repair services. If you see curling or bending roof shingles, it's crucial to inspect your roof covering a lot more carefully.

Granules in Gutters
Granules in your rain gutters can signal that your roofing is nearing completion of its life expectancy. These little, loose particles typically originate from asphalt tiles, which naturally wear down in time. If you discover an accumulation of granules, it's a sign that your roof shingles are wearing away and may no more be providing adequate defense for your home.
As you examine your gutters, pay attention to the amount of granules present. A few granules occasionally can be typical, especially after a storm. Nonetheless, if you locate a significant buildup or if your gutters are continually filled with these particles, it's time to act.
Granules offer an important purpose-- they assist shield your roof shingles from UV rays and contribute to their total durability. When they begin to remove, your roof covering becomes more susceptible to damages.
Disregarding granules in your gutters can cause much more extreme issues down the line, consisting of leaks and architectural troubles. Water Spots on Ceilings
When you see water stains on your ceilings, it's often a clear indicator that your roof is endangered. These discolorations typically appear as brownish or yellow spots, and they signify that water is infiltrating your home.
While this could be due to a small problem, it's vital to take it seriously, as it might point to considerable roofing damages.
You need to check out the resource of the stains. Check your attic room for leaks or damp insulation, and check roof covering tiles for crinkling, fracturing, or missing items.
If you see any of these indications, it's important to act rapidly. Overlooking the issue can result in further damage, such as mold development or structural concerns.
Consider the possibility that the water can come from pipes instead of your roofing. If you can't determine the problem, speak with a roofing specialist for a thorough inspection.
They can identify whether the discolorations are undoubtedly roof-related or if it's a pipes trouble.

Mold or Mold Development
If you spot mold or mold growth in your attic room or on your ceiling, it's a solid sign that your roof covering might be compromised. These unattractive patches can establish due to extended wetness, typically an indicator of roofing concerns. The existence of mold and mildew or mold recommends that water is getting in someplace, creating a wet setting that fosters growth.
You may notice dark places or a moldy odor when you venture right into your attic. If you do, do not overlook these signs. Mold and mildew not only impact your home's appearances yet can also posture major wellness threats. Breathing in mold spores can result in breathing problems and allergic reactions, specifically for delicate people.
If you find mold and mildew or mildew, it's time to examine additionally. Look for leaks, damaged roof shingles, or locations where water could be merging.
It's important to deal with these issues promptly to stop additional damages to your home. Replacing your roof covering may be required to quit dampness seepage and protect your home.

Sagging Roofline
A drooping roofline can stimulate issue concerning the integrity of your home. When you notice a dip or droop in your roof covering, it's a clear indication that something's incorrect. This problem frequently stems from architectural damage, which could be as a result of age, water damages, and even hefty snow buildup.
Ignoring it will not make the issue disappear; in fact, it can result in a lot more substantial damage.
You should examine your roofline frequently. Try to find unequal inclines or recognizable dips. If you find any kind of signs of sagging, it's necessary to attend to the problem immediately. A sagging roof can compromise your home's stability, making it harmful for you and your household.
In addition, if you discover cracks in the wall surfaces or ceilings inside your home, these could be related to the sagging roof.
